  • What is the Ashton & Parsons Teething Gel?
    Ashton & Parsons Teething Gel is a specially formulated gel that helps relieve the pain and discomfort associated with teething in babies and toddlers. It provides targeted, fast-acting relief, helping soothe sore gums and reduce fussiness, allowing your baby to feel more at ease during this challenging phase.

    How does the Ashton & Parsons Teething Gel work?
    The gel contains mild anesthetic properties that quickly target and soothe the gums upon application. It’s designed for easy application, allowing parents to safely apply it directly to the affected gums. The gentle ingredients provide instant relief without causing harm to sensitive baby gums.

     

  • Apply a small amount of gel onto a clean finger and gently massage it directly onto your baby's sore gums. Repeat as necessary, following the guidelines on the packaging. Ensure hands are clean before each application.

     

  • Some babies may experience minor irritation at the application site. If irritation persists, discontinue use and consult a healthcare professional. If you notice any signs of an allergic reaction, seek medical advice immediately.

Frequently asked questions
  • How often can I use Ashton & Parsons Teething Gel?

    Apply as directed on the packaging, but avoid excessive use. Consult a healthcare professional if pain persists.

  • Is Ashton & Parsons Teething Gel safe for newborns?

    This gel is generally recommended for babies over 3 months. For newborns, consult your GP before use.

  • Can I use the teething gel with other medications?

    Ashton & Parsons Teething Gel is safe on its own; however, check with a pharmacist if you’re using other medications.

  • How long does the effect last after applying?

    Relief is often felt within minutes and typically lasts a few hours, but this may vary for each child.

  • Is Ashton & Parsons Teething Gel sugar-free?

    Yes, this gel is sugar-free, making it safe for baby teeth.
